2019 AFCON: Five Takeaways From Nigeria's 1-0 Win Against Guinea
Published: June 26, 2019
The Super Eagles on Wednesday confirmed their place in the second round (Round of 16) of the 2019 AFCON with a 1-0 win over Guinea at the Alexandria Stadium.
Izuchukwu Okosi takes a look at the five takeaways from the game.
1. Full Backs Not Supporting Attacking Efforts
The duo of Ola Aina and Chidozie Awaziem were not overly bad in defending on Wednesday but Nigeria's game is mostly orchestrated from the wings and the full backs did not deliver on this much in this contest.
2. Guinea's Good Defensive Solidity
The Syli National of Guinea were defensive in approach and only threatened a few times.
This frustrated the Nigerians as they struggled to create clear cut scoring chances.
3. Iwobi's Substitution Almost Costly
Although the Arsenal forward misplaced a few passes and made some poor decisions he did create goal scoring chances and had a shot at goal.
The Eagles midfield broke down after his substitution, the Guineans flew out of their traps but thankfully the Nigerians held on to their slim lead.
4. Akpeyi's Howlers
The Kaizer Chiefs keeper was literally untested by the Guineans but he dropped a few clangers which ultimately did not cost the team.
The goalkeeping situation in the Super Eagles is dicey. It is not inconceivable to believe that Gernot Rohr does not really know who to trust best among his goalkeepers.
5. Second Half Eagles
Like they did against Burundi, the Super Eagles upped their ante in the second half.
It clearly shows that they have had better second halves so far but it is time they started scoring early - in the first halves as they encounter more difficult opposition in the knockout stages.
